Cattle egrets hitch a ride on domestic cows and eat insects that are stirred up by their activity. What term describes this relationship?

Biological  interactions include different types of interactions between organisms that reside together in a community.

Cattle egrets show interaction with domestic cows and feed on the insects present in them. The cattle egrets get food from the cows, while there is no benefit or harm to the cows. This type of biological relationship is known as commensalism, in which one organism, out of interacting organisms, get benefit, while other organism neither harmed or benefit.  

Thus, the term that describes this relationship is 'commensalism.'
